Booking confirmed by mistake

Hi everyone,

I confirmed a booking in error (more than three months out from stay date)and realised within two hours. I immediately messaged the guest but she didn't see the message until outside the 48hr free cancellation period.

Guest is understanding and happy to find other accommodation however is concerned she won't get her deposit back so wants me (host) to cancel the reservation.

I am very happy to give all her money back but am uncertain if I can do this.

Airbnb will charge me $50 USD (around $70 in my country) for this error plus loss of Superhost status etc so I would much prefer she did the cancellation.

The rules seem very inflexible considering the date is so far away and the guest is easily able to find other accommodation.

Is there anything I can do?

@Suz-And-Ted0  As the guest is understanding and agreeable, ask her again to cancel, assuring her that you will refund any money she is out for the service fees and whatever she isn't refunded according to your cancellation policy. In other words, make sure she isn't out anything for the booking. You can do this through the resolution center option "Send Money". Make sure she understands that any security deposit you charge wasn't actually charged to her account when she booked and that Airbnb has her money at this point, not the host.
